Record Detail

Runtime Error

/in/lab4.c: In function 'my_gcvt':
/in/lab4.c:22:7: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
  if(sz>=ndigits)
       ^~
/in/lab4.c:28:15: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
  for(int i=0;i<ndigits-sz;i++)
               ^
/in/lab4.c:12:9: warning: unused variable 'times' [-Wunused-variable]
     int times=0;
         ^~~~~
/in/lab4.c: In function 'main':
/in/lab4.c:182:31: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
             for (int i = 0; i < strlen(LineCommand); ++i)
                               ^
/in/lab4.c:186:31: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
             for (int i = 0; i < strlen(LineCommand); ++i)
                               ^
/in/lab4.c:193:31: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
             for (int i = 0; i < strlen(tempname); ++i)
                               ^
/in/lab4.c:248:27: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
             for (int i=0;i<strlen(DirPart)-1;i++)
                           ^
/in/lab4.c:293:27: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
         for (int i = 0; i < strlen(LineCommand); ++i)
                           ^
/in/lab4.c:325:27: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
         for (int i = 0; i < strlen(LineCommand); ++i)
                           ^
/in/lab4.c:330:21: warning: unused variable 'flag2' [-Wunused-variable]
                 int flag2=i;
                     ^~~~~
/in/lab4.c:380:22: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
         for(int i=0;i<strlen(LineCommand);i++)//turn algebra command into IPE
                      ^
/in/lab4.c:385:21: warning: unused variable 'pa' [-Wunused-variable]
                 int pa=i,pb=i;
                     ^~
/in/lab4.c:525:31: warning: comparison between signed and unsigned integer expressions [-Wsign-compare]
             for (int i = 0; i < strlen(DIR)-1; ++i)
                               ^
/in/lab4.c:122:27: warning: unused parameter 'argv' [-Wunused-parameter]
 int main(int argc, char** argv) {
                           ^~~~
/in/lab4.c:277:55: warning: 'L2' may be used uninitialized in this function [-Wmaybe-uninitialized]
                 substr(TempCommand,LineCommand,L1+1,L2-L1-1);
                                                     ~~^~~
/in/lab4.c:259:22: warning: 'P2' may be used uninitialized in this function [-Wmaybe-uninitialized]
             for (int i = P2+1; i < 130; ++i) //assume "," appear only once
                      ^
/in/lab4.c:237:22: warning: 'P1' may be used uninitialized in this function [-Wmaybe-uninitialized]
             for (int i = P1+1; i < 120; ++i)
                      ^
# Status Time Cost Memory Cost
#1 Runtime Error (1) Detail 27ms 7.309 MiB

Information

Submit By
Type
Submission
Homework
Lab 4 (TEST ONLY)
Language
C
Submit At
2021-10-30 12:18:20
Judged At
2021-11-21 14:58:33
Judged By
Score
0
Total Time
27ms
Peak Memory
7.309 MiB